2. What about pizza?
Pizza is a pretty direct dish available
throughout the world in any fast food chains in
the mall and expressway, family restaurants or
even fine dining cafes, bistros, restaurants
serving Italian, Italian-fusion or even other
types of cuisine. It has come far and wide
from the invention of its modern version in
Naples, Italy over a century ago. It is called
several names in other countries like pide in
Turkey, pite in Albania though pizza is
understood in any part of the world.
In its most plain method, a pizza is an oven-baked flat, usually round leavened dough
topped with a sauce, cheese and other toppings. With this idea, Italians assemble it
in a variety of ways usually with varying toppings. Other countries have adapted it to
their own versions to suit cultural preferences and ingredients availability.
Restaurants can either be contemporarily designed or traditionally like authentic and
genuine Italian pizzerias.
3. The basic component is the crust forming base which can be rolled out and/or
hand tossed very thinly. As in the case of most old-fashioned Italian pizza or
thickly for other versions which hold more toppings like deep dish or stuffed
crust varieties popularized in the United States. Toppings vary from the most
simple olive oil, tomato, basil and buffalo milk mozzarella cheese to countless
other varieties.
Some prevalent Italian flavors include margherita with tomato, mozzarella, basil
and extra-virgin olive oil; romana with tomato, mozzarella, anchovies and
oregano; capricciosa with artichokes, cooked ham and olives and the plain
looking but calorie-rich quattro formaggi translated as “four cheese”.
The exclusive pizzas of old were
baked in wood fired ovens. These
are still in use in traditional pizzerias.
Other restaurants even restore these
ovens and display them at the front
of the house so people can watch
their orders coming out piping hot
from the oven to their table
4. Modern restaurants which serve it by the dozen usually have an electric oven with
top and bottom heating elements and a constructed in conveyor belt which rolls
them in and cooks them at an exact time so when it comes out it is consistent.
Tools in making and serving pizzas comprise the long-handled peel, pizza stone (for
home cooking to recreate the effect of a brick oven) and pizza wheel.
With globalization taking foreign dining ideas to every corner of the world, small
entrepreneurs and multinational franchise companies have taken this popular
food to the masses who will not ever set foot in Italy. Shakey’s and Domino’s have
set up franchises with multi-restaurant presence in several countries.
They often contribute aggressively for
market share with campaigns like
discount deals, loyalty cards and
promotions like “we deliver in time or
it’s free”. Independently owned
pizzerias boast of giant pizzas the size
of a dining table that can serve
dozens of people.
5. Modernizations in the world of
pizza training and demonstrations
came variety of ways. Several
countries make their own flavors
which others might discover
unusual: Japan makes mochi which
makes use of a crust of glutinous
rice flour while India tops theirs
with chicken tandoori. There are
also dessert pizzas which consume
sweet toppings of thickened milk or
cream and fruits. Pizza can also be
made at home from scratch or
bought from the supermarket
frozen.
